Madeleine Gavin
"Exploring the depths of human resilience and courage through the lens of her camera, Madeleine Gavin, born in 1962 in Brooklyn, New York, USA, has been actively directing films since the late 90s. Known for her distinct focus on documentary films, she has gained recognition for her works such as "City of Joy" that explore a raw and real side of life, often capturing the triumphs of the human spirit against adversities. Despite not having bagged major film festival awards, her work is highly respected in the industry for its authenticity and empathy.
